Understanding Medial Nasal Alar Incision

Medial nasal alar incision is a surgical procedure that can be performed for both cosmetic and functional reasons. It is commonly used in rhinoplasty to address issues such as wide or flared nostrils, which can create an imbalance in the appearance of the nose and face. In some cases, it may also be used to correct functional problems related to the nasal structure.

According to lmmedicalnyc.com, large or flared nostrils are often genetic and can be an ethnic trait. Nostril reduction surgery and alar base reduction are options available for patients seeking to adjust the size and shape of their nostrils. Small, discreet incisions can be made at the base of the nose or in the crease alongside the nose at the cheek and in the nostril to achieve the desired results.

Evaluating Public Hospitals in New York City

Top - Ranked Public Hospitals

U.S. News provides valuable information on the best hospitals for ear, nose, and throat in New York. Some of the well - known public hospitals with strong ENT departments that could potentially perform medial nasal alar incision procedures include:

Hospital Name Rank in ENT Score Adult Specialties Ranked Nationally Pediatric Specialties Ranked Nationally
New York - Presbyterian Hospital - Columbia and Cornell #13 81.0 / 100 14 10
NYU Langone Hospitals #26 71.4 / 100 14 3
Mount Sinai Hospital #35 63.7 / 100 11 3

Advantages of Public Hospitals

  • Affordability: Public hospitals are often more cost - effective, especially for patients with limited financial resources or those relying on government - sponsored insurance programs. Many public hospitals offer services at a lower cost due to government subsidies and their mission to serve the broader community.
  • Research and Innovation: Public hospitals are frequently at the forefront of medical research and innovation. They may participate in clinical trials and research projects, which can lead to the availability of the latest treatment methods and technologies for patients. For example, some public hospitals may be involved in research related to minimally invasive techniques for nasal alar incision.
  • Multidisciplinary Care: These hospitals usually have a large pool of specialists from various fields. In the case of a nasal alar incision procedure, patients can benefit from the expertise of ENT surgeons, plastic surgeons, anesthesiologists, and other healthcare professionals working together to provide comprehensive care.

Disadvantages of Public Hospitals

  • Long Wait Times: Due to the high volume of patients, public hospitals may have longer wait times for appointments, surgeries, and follow - up care. This can be a significant drawback for patients who need timely treatment.
  • Crowded Facilities: Public hospitals often experience overcrowding, which can lead to a less comfortable environment for patients. Limited privacy and longer waiting areas can affect the overall patient experience.

Advantages of Private Hospitals

  • Personalized Care: Private hospitals typically offer more personalized attention to patients. They may have smaller patient - to - staff ratios, allowing for more individualized treatment plans and better communication between patients and healthcare providers.
  • Comfort and Amenities: These hospitals often provide a more comfortable and luxurious environment. Patients may enjoy private rooms, better food options, and enhanced amenities, which can contribute to a more pleasant hospital stay.
  • Faster Service: Private hospitals generally have shorter wait times for appointments and surgeries. Patients can often schedule procedures more quickly, which is beneficial for those who want to start their treatment without delay.

Disadvantages of Private Hospitals

  • High Cost: Private hospitals are usually more expensive than public hospitals. The cost of services, including surgical procedures, consultations, and medications, can be significantly higher. This may not be affordable for all patients, especially those without adequate insurance coverage.
  • Limited Insurance Coverage: Some private hospitals may have limited acceptance of certain insurance plans. Patients may need to check with their insurance provider to ensure that the hospital and the procedure are covered, which can be a complex and time - consuming process.

Quality of Care Measures

Hospitals are evaluated based on various quality measures, such as patient injuries, medication errors, complication rates, readmission rates, and mortality rates. Patients can obtain this information from websites like Medicare.gov/hospitalcompare/search.html. A hospital with better quality scores is generally a safer choice for surgery.

Cost of Medial Nasal Alar Incision

The cost of a medial nasal alar incision procedure can vary widely depending on several factors. According to nycfacedoc.com, the average cost of alarplasty (nostril reduction surgery) in NYC ranges from $3,000 to $7,000. However, this range can be influenced by the following:

  • Surgeon's Experience: Experienced surgeons with a good reputation may charge higher fees.
  • Complexity of the Procedure: If the surgery requires more extensive work on the cartilage or is combined with other rhinoplasty procedures, the cost will be higher.
  • Facility and Anesthesia Fees: Private hospitals may have higher facility fees compared to public hospitals. The type of anesthesia used (general or local) can also affect the cost.
  • Post - operative Care: The cost of follow - up visits, medications, and aftercare products should also be considered.

It is important to note that most alarplasty procedures are considered cosmetic and may not be covered by health insurance. However, if the surgery is performed to correct functional issues, such as breathing difficulties, some insurance providers may cover a portion of the costs.
